What is Beckham'd It?
1.
phrase coined in Euro 2004 by a british broadcaster during a Netherlands vs Sweden quarterfinal match.
Originates from an England vs Portugal quarterfinal when famed English set kicker David Beckham blasted a penalty shot 20 feet over the cross bar.
Commonly used now whenever someone shoots a puck/soccerball/basketball miles above the target. Works for pretty much any sport.
Joe Sakic is in alone on a breakaway! he shoots! Ohhh! and he's beckham'd it!
